When using bathing facilities in Japanese hotels, especially onsens, it’s important to familiarize yourself with local etiquette. Generally, you must wash and rinse your body thoroughly before entering shared baths to maintain cleanliness. Swimwear is typically not allowed, as bathing is usually done in the nude—though some hotels do offer private baths for those uncomfortable with this practice. Additionally, it’s advised to keep noise levels down and to respect the tranquility of the space to ensure a serene environment for all guests.
